What is Buterick Bulkheading?
Buterick Bulkheading, Inc. is a seasoned marine construction firm headquartered in Southern Ocean County, New Jersey. Since its inception in 1954, the company has built a formidable reputation for its expertise in bulkhead replacements, pile driving, and the installation of custom piers. Leveraging innovative techniques and high-quality materials, including advanced vinyl sheathing for bulkheads, Buterick Bulkheading serves a diverse clientele encompassing both residential and commercial sectors. Their project experience includes significant undertakings such as the Seaside Heights Boardwalk and numerous New Jersey state marinas. Beyond core services, the company also provides boat lifts and dock construction, offering comprehensive, client-specific marine solutions.
